Output 18a0e78ce0f3761aab7129f5e1a687fb5614b5717df028d996df5e7e9a3de6b8:4

value
500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9c3adc87451bf9ce97a5cb30acb34c9a186bf3c9 OP_EQUAL
address
3Fw5rEWhaMaMjk81Rfos2tuAwXyGKhuhbe
transaction
18a0e78ce0f3761aab7129f5e1a687fb5614b5717df028d996df5e7e9a3de6b8
confirmations
342204
spent
true